Don’t Let Nigerian Businessmen Into My Meetings In The US, Buhari Warns Aides


President Muhammadu Buhari on Monday in Washington DC warned close aides
not to smuggle anyone into his official meetings with US officials.
Sources
said he gave the warning during a breakfast meeting at his Blair House
official digs in Washington DC, telling them any infractions will result
with the person involved being fired with immediate effect.
President
Buhari told them the purpose of his visit was not to meet with Nigerian
businessmen or politicians, but with US officials and Nigerians in the
Diaspora.
During the tense meeting, at which eight of the aides
were present, Buhari directed the Department of 

State Protocol in Abuja
to open a desk at the Aso Rock Villa that would facilitate direct access
to him if any Nigerian wants to see him in Nigeria. He said the desk
will eliminate the role of corrupt officials, middlemen and family
members who profit from selling access to the Presidency.
